Analord

Analord is a series of eleven 12" vinyl records by the electronic music artist Richard D. James, most of which are released under the alias AFX.

The series, released in 2005, marked James's return to primarily analogue equipment following his computer-oriented programming work in the late 1990s.

[6] On 24 December 2009 the Rephlex Records website began posting unreleased/bonus tracks for the Analord series in MP3 and WAV digital formats.

[7] The first installment, Analord 10, went on sale through the Rephlex Records website on 15 December 2004, and was packaged in a faux-leather binder with sleeves for housing the rest of the series.

[8][9] A condensed, album-length version of the series, Chosen Lords, was released in 2006.
